The Testing Inspection Certification (TIC) market is poised for significant growth, expecting to escalate to approximately $106.98 billion by 2035, driven by an annual compound growth rate (CAGR) of 4.88%. This robust demand is largely attributable to increasing regulatory requirements and heightened quality assurance standards across various sectors. Companies are increasingly seeking reliable TIC services to enhance product quality and ensure compliance, which is crucial in competitive marketplaces. As globalization continues to push businesses toward stringent quality protocols, the TIC market's expansion is projected to be meteoric.
Stakeholders are particularly attentive to the demand surge in North America, recognized as the largest TIC market, where regulatory compliance is emphasized. The region's adherence to safety standards, combined with a growing industrial base, is creating a fertile ground for TIC services. Moreover, the Asia-Pacific region is emerging as the fastest-growing sector, fueled by rapid industrialization and a shift towards higher quality benchmarks. In the contemporary landscape, the TIC market is defined by a few prominent players who dominate the sector. Leading market players include SGS (CH), Bureau Veritas (FR), and Intertek (GB), each contributing significantly to the industry's growth trajectory. These companies have established a robust presence across various geographical regions and sectors, offering a comprehensive suite of services that cater to diverse client needs The development of Testing Inspection Certification Market future outlook continues to influence strategic direction within the sector.
Recent developments in technology have further propelled the growth of TIC services. Companies like TÜV Rheinland (DE) and TÜV SÜD (DE) are investing in innovative testing solutions that leverage advanced technologies such as artificial intelligence and machine learning. This commitment to innovation allows them to provide enhanced accuracy in testing and inspection, thereby meeting the evolving demands of industries. Moreover, DNV GL (NO) and Applus+ (ES) are continuously expanding their service portfolios to include sustainable practices, addressing the growing concern for environmental impact among consumers and manufacturers alike.

Regionally, the Testing Inspection Certification market displays significant disparities. North America retains its position as the dominant player, representing a substantial market share due to stringent regulatory requirements. The prevalence of established industries, particularly in manufacturing and pharmaceuticals, underpins this dominance.
Conversely, the Asia-Pacific region is witnessing a remarkable upsurge in demand, attributed to rapid industrial growth and rising quality standards. This region is projected to exhibit the highest CAGR as countries like China and India enhance their focus on compliance and quality assurance.
